Sound is configured correctly & works during installation. On reboot, sound is  
not available.  
hobbes:/home/dan/ # rcalsasound status  
ALSA sound driver not loaded.                                         unused  
  
hobbes:/home/dan/ # rcalsasound restart  
Starting sound driver:  intel8x0                                      done  
  
Restores sound.  
  
alsasound is set to be activated in runlevels 3 & 5

Comment 3 Takashi Iwai 2005-10-14 10:36:02 UTC
alsasound init script itself doesn't load modules any more unlike 9.3.  The
modules are supposed to be loaded via hotplug/udev.  See README.SuSE in alsa
package.

Check /etc/sysconfig/hardware/hwcfg-* files whether any of them includes
snd-intel8x0 module.  If not, try to reconfigure the sound via yast2.
(Don't use alsaconf.  It's been buggy for SL10.0.)

Comment 7 Ladislav Slezák 2005-10-19 06:34:38 UTC
I have found this in y2log:
2005-10-14 12:44:00 <1> hobbes(15480) [YCP] sound/write_routines.ycp:188 using hwcfg file: hwcfg-bus-pci-0000:00:1f.5
2005-10-14 12:44:00 <1> hobbes(15480) [YCP] sound/write_routines.ycp:292 Removing file: bus-pci-0000:00:1f.5

It means that yast creates the hwcfg file, but it's immediately deleted - see bug #116483.

The workaround is to remove the sound card, exit the yast module (write/activate the changes), restart the yast module and finally configure the sound card. Then it should work.

*** This bug has been marked as a duplicate of 116483 ***
